Course Content

Media Relations Strategy for Tech Companies
Crafting Compelling Narratives in the Tech Sector (Includes keywords: storytelling, press release)
Building and Managing Relationships with Tech Journalists (Includes keywords: media outreach, influencer marketing)
Crisis Communication in the Technology Industry (Includes keywords: reputation management, risk assessment)
Digital PR and Social Media for Tech (Includes keywords: social media marketing, content marketing, SEO)
Measuring and Reporting on Media Relations Success (Includes keywords: analytics, ROI, reporting)
Legal and Ethical Considerations in Tech Media Relations
Understanding the Tech Media Landscape (Includes keywords: media analysis, target audience)
Advanced Media Training for Tech Spokespeople

Career Role Description
Technology PR Specialist (UK) Develop and execute media relations strategies for tech clients, securing positive media coverage across major UK publications. Expertise in pitching and building relationships with journalists essential.
Senior Media Relations Manager - SaaS (UK) Lead media relations efforts for a Software as a Service (SaaS) company, managing a team and crafting compelling narratives. Deep understanding of the UK tech landscape is crucial.
Tech Communications Consultant (UK) Provide expert media relations counsel to technology companies, helping them navigate challenging media situations and build their brand reputation. Strong crisis communication skills needed.
Digital PR Executive - Fintech (UK) Focus on digital media relations for a financial technology company, leveraging online channels and influencer marketing to boost brand visibility in the UK.
